Rule 89 Decision on admissibility
1.
The
Commission
shall
consider
the report of the Rapporteurs,
decide on the admissibility of the
Communication,
and
shall
inform
the parties accordingly.
The Commission shall give reasons
for its decision on admissibility.

In the case of acceptance of the draft
Memorandum of Understanding, the
States Parties concerned shall sign
the agreement under the auspices of
the Commission.
The Rapporteur shall then prepare
a draft report, which
shall be
submitted to the Commission for
adoption at its next session.
When adopted, the report shall be
sent to the States Parties concerned
and communicated to the Assembly.
The
Commission,
through
the
Rapporteur shall then follow-up
on monitoring the implementation
of the terms of the agreement and
report on the said implementation to
each subsequent Ordinary Session of
the Commission until the settlement
is concluded. Such a report shall
form part of the Activity Report of
the Commission to the Assembly
